Banasura Sagar Dam, located in the foothills of the Banasura mountain range, is the second-largest earth dam in Asia and an ideal spot for a family day out. The dam is surrounded by the Banasura Hill Resort, which offers a host of activities like trekking, boating, and ziplining, giving you an opportunity to enjoy nature's bounty. Spread over 345 sq. km, the Wayanad Wildlife Sanctuary is home to an array of wildlife species, including elephants, tigers, leopards, and deer. Take your family on a wildlife safari and explore the lush green forest and its inhabitants. The sanctuary also boasts a variety of flora, including medicinal plants and orchids. You can also opt for a nature walk or trekking to explore the sanctuary's beauty.
Located on Ambukuthi Hill, Edakkal Caves are two natural caves that feature prehistoric rock etchings. The caves are accessible by a 1 km uphill trek, and the view from the top is breathtaking. The etchings in the cave depict human and animal figures, tools, and other objects, providing a fascinating glimpse into the past. Visiting this site with your family is a great way to learn about the region's history and evolution.
Pookode Lake is a natural freshwater lake surrounded by lush green forests. The lake is a popular tourist spot, thanks to its serene surroundings and the various activities it offers. You can take a paddleboat ride, go on a short nature walk, or simply sit by the lake and enjoy the peaceful ambiance. A visit to Pookode Lake is a perfect way to spend a leisurely afternoon with your family.
